Neath around 0833 on 30/12/2025
Departures
Arrivals
Simple
Detailed
Buy tickets to Neath
through Realtime Tickets, our new ticket portal
0817
Brecon Bus Interchange
Bus service
Transport for Wales service
0827
Carmarthen
Arrived at 0828
Great Western Railway · 10 coaches
2
0848
Swansea
Arrived at 0847
Transport for Wales · 4 coaches
2
0850
Cardiff Central
Arrived at 0857
Transport for Wales · 2 coaches
1
0905
Brecon Bus Interchange
Bus service
Transport for Wales service
0855
Bristol Temple Meads
Arrived at 0902
Great Western Railway · 5 coaches
1
0927
Swansea
Arrived at 0926
Great Western Railway · 9 coaches
2
0928
London Paddington
Arrived at 0933
Great Western Railway · 5 coaches
1
0950
Swansea
Arrived on time
Transport for Wales · 2 coaches
2
1001
Crewe
Arrived at 1006
Transport for Wales · 4 coaches
1